NEC convinced Emre Mor; two-year contract ready

After a successful trial in Nijmegen, Emre Mor has convinced the NEC and has a two-year contract on the horizon. The 28-year-old winger has already played in preseason matches against De Treffers and MSV Duisburg.

Emre Mor is ready to give a new phase in his career. It is confirmed that the 28-year-old winger convinced the NEC management and coach Dick Schreuder during the trial held in Nijmegen. According to club signals, a two-year contract is in place for the Turkish international, and the next step is expected to be easy if the final details are settled. Mor arrived in the Netherlands as a free agent after his contract with Fenerbahçe expired. Last season, he didn't play even one minute and wasn't even included in the matchday squad, part of his problem with injuries. He was also not registered for the second part of the campaign, causing the player's side to part ways with the giant Turkish club. Despite a lackluster last year, Mor remains known as a former top prospect in Europe. Born and shaped in Denmark, he is a product of FC Nordsjaelland's youth system. After only 13 games in the first team, Borussia Dortmund moved quickly in 2016 and acquired him in a transfer that almost reached ten million euros. A year later, Dortmund sold him to Celta de Vigo for an estimated three million euro profit.
Image
His potential never caught on in Spain and in the following years Mor went through several loan spells. In 2022, he moved to Turkey and was later bought by Fenerbahçe. However, he played a very limited role there, until completely missing a game for the entirety of last season. Arriving at the NEC, the winger seems to have renewed energy. He has taken part in preseason friendlies, including matches against De Treffers and MSV Duisburg, where he showed off his pace and ability to handle the ball—traits that made him stand out as a youth. Under coach Dick Schreuder, he is expected to be given a clear system and role, something he has long sought in recent years. For NEC, the two-year offer could be a low-risk, high-upside move. If Mor can return to the form that brought him to Dortmund and Celta, he could be an x-factor in the Nijmegen side's attack in the upcoming Eredivisie campaign. More importantly, he will add depth and creativity in wide areas—a need often overlooked in the modern game.
